Oshibana is the ancient Japanese art, dating back to the Samurai of the 16th century, of creating paintings using pressed petals, leaves and plants, dried and placed on a sheet of rice paper. The components are arranged in floral designs that combine the intensity of colour with the beauty of form, instilling deep meaning.
